VBA na sto dwa, czyli 102 ćwiczenia z wykorzystaniem VBA - ebook
VBA na sto dwa, czyli 102 ćwiczenia z wykorzystaniem VBA - ebook
Co Ty wiesz o VBA?
Co wiesz i co potrafisz ... to dwie różne sprawy. Od wiedzy do umiejętności prowadzi droga usłana... praktyką. A praktykę najlepiej i najbezpieczniej zdobywa się nie w zawodowym boju, gdy na ręce patrzą szef, koledzy z teamu i klient na dodatek, tylko w zaciszu własnego pokoju, przy ulubionym biurku, na ulubionym krześle, w czasie wolnym. Ćwicząc i bawiąc się po prostu! I właśnie w tym celu powstała ta książka. Autor zawarł w niej 102 ćwiczenia, dzięki którym przejdziesz od teorii do praktyki Visual Basic for Applications i będziesz gotów do swobodnego tworzenia własnych programów.
Rozwiązanie zaproponowanych ćwiczeń wymaga stosowania pętli For-Next, For Each-Next, Do-Until, Do-While, struktur If-Then-Else, Select Case, funkcji Excel i VBA, odwołania do metod lub właściwości obiektów itd. Wielokrotne wykonywanie podobnych czynności gwarantuje, że polecenia zapadną Ci w pamięć. Książka pomoże Ci wykształcić programistyczny sposób myślenia, niezbędny do tworzenia własnych rozwiązań. Każdy rozdział składa się z jednego lub kilku ćwiczeń, które polegają na napisaniu procedur Sub lub Function. Do wszystkich poleceń dołączono przykładowe rozwiązania. Na początek możesz z nich skorzystać, potem jednak szukaj własnych rozwiązań.
Do dzieła:
- Stwórz tabliczkę mnożenia
- Sprawdź, kiedy wypadnie najbliższy piątek trzynastego
- Policz dni wolne od pracy w kolejnym roku
- Napisz własny przelicznik walut
- Dowiedz się, czy trzymasz prawidłową masę ciała...
...a to dopiero początek zabawy!
Spis treści
Wstęp 7
1. Tabliczka mnożenia 11
2. Rok przestępny 17
3. Piątek trzynastego 19
4. Kalkulator wieku 25
5. Miesiące na literę 29
6. Dni wolne od pracy 33
7. Liczby palindromiczne 37
8. NWD i NWW 39
9. Liczby pierwsze 43
10. Liczby półpierwsze 47
11. Liczby emirp 49
12. Liczby pierwsze bliźniacze 53
13. Tabliczka mnożenia - cd. 55
14. Trójkąt Floyda 59
15. Trójkąt Pascala 61
16. Szyfr gaderypoluki 65
17. Szyfr zegarowy 69
18. Alfabet Morse'a 73
19. Liczby narcystyczne 77
20. Liczby automorficzne 81
21. Liczby kanadyjskie 83
22. Liczby faktorion 87
23. Liczby Nivena 89
24. Wartości unikatowe i duplikaty - komórki 91
25. Sortowanie arkuszy 95
26. Sortowanie cyfr w liczbach 97
27. Porównywanie liczb 101
28. Zapełnianie komórek 103
29. Piwotowanie danych 107
30. Sortowanie elementów tablicy 111
31. Elementy unikatowe i wspólne - tablice 115
32. Liczby doskonałe i prawie doskonałe 121
33. Liczby zaprzyjaźnione 125
34. Liczby Sastry'ego 129
35. Liczby Münchhausena 131
36. Liczby Catalana 133
37. Zygodromy 135
38. Czas zimowy, czas letni 137
39. Palindromy 141
40. PESEL 143
41. Koniunkcja planet 149
42. Miesiąc synodyczny 151
43. Wielkanoc 155
44. Generator liczb losowych 159
45. Wskaźnik BMI 165
46. Liczby rzymskie 169
47. Ciąg Fibonacciego 175
48. Ciąg Jacobsthala 179
49. Liczby wielokątne 181
50. Podział koła 185
51. Suma magiczna i magiczny kwadrat 187
52. Ciąg Conwaya 191
53. Kombinatoryka 193
54. Sto drzwi 201
55. Przelicznik walut 203
56. Odległość na kuli 207
57. Ślimak 211
58. Zygzak 215
59. Liczba kolista 219
60. Liczby taksówkowe 221
61. Liczba wampir - policz kły 225
62. Zamiana godzin na tekst 229
63. Zamiana liczb na tekst 235
64. Szyfr Cezara 241
65. Szyfr Vigenere'a 245
Kategoria: | Systemy operacyjne |
Zabezpieczenie: |
Watermark
|
ISBN: | 978-83-283-7853-7 |
Rozmiar pliku: | 6,0 MB |